I have both German and English as my languages and as the languages my server supports.

Choosing a language on every post is kinda tedious, I forget to do it most of the time. Sometimes this leads to the post not being able to send, but on some subs it does send, but with the wrong language setting.

I mostly post in English, but unfortunately German is the default chosen setting, I think because it is in the top of the list.

I don’t even think that a language setting necessarily is a bad idea, but the way it works it differs massively from reddit, right?

Also when I sent a post, I can’t see which language I did choose, so I have to click edit to see if I set it correctly. It’s not a good user experience to choose this setting but then not having indicated what influence it has and which setting I used to post.

Anyways, lemmy is great nonetheless.

  • @wiki_me@lemmy.ml
    link
    fedilink
    41 year ago

    I don’t see a post asking for automatic detection of language, maybe you can submit a issue on github for that?

  • @ray@lemmy.ml
    link
    fedilink
    English
    41 year ago

    I didn’t even know there was an option to set language in the settings. Might be nice to add a tooltip for that when someone doesn’t have a language set.

  • AdaA
    link
    English
    31 year ago

    This is more a workaround than an answer, but if you make sure your language settings are set to English, German and Undetermined, then it will default to undetermined for your posts, and that will always work!

  • @nutomic@lemmy.mlM
    link
    fedilink
    English
    21 year ago

    The language should be chosen automatically if possible: For posts: - If the community only allows one language, it should select that - If the user only has one language, it should be selected by default - Otherwise, if the overlap of user languages and community languages contains one item, that should be selected by default

    • For comments it should automatically select the language of the parent post/comment

    So communities should definitely set their allowed languages to help automate this. Instances as well, as this will also limit community languages to be a subset of instance languages.

    Its possible that there are still some bugs. I also think that for the default language selection when posting, “undetermined” should not be considered

    cc @dessalines@lemmy.ml